Breaking Down the Studies
Alcon recently revealed the results of its comprehensive time and motion studies at prominent ophthalmology meetings worldwide. The studies compared UNITY VCS with other leading systems like CONSTELLATION and CENTURION during vitreoretinal and cataract surgeries. With a sample size comprising various surgical cases, the studies documented notable enhancements in efficiency. UNITY VCS exhibited a 16% improvement in the overall workflow for vitreoretinal surgeries, significantly reducing set-up and tear-down times. These efficiencies are particularly valuable in today’s demanding surgical environment, where maximizing operating room utilization is key.
Surgeon Testimonials Highlight Benefits
Leading surgeons involved in the research have highlighted how these efficiencies provide tangible benefits in their practices. Dr. John Kitchens, a retina surgeon and lead investigator, emphasized that these operational savings are instrumental in maintaining high OR throughput. Similarly, Dr. Lawrence Woodard, involved in cataract surgery studies, noted how these efficiencies help his team stay focused on delivering optimal patient care.
Key observations from these studies include:
- UNITY VCS achieves a 16% efficiency gain in vitreoretinal surgeries.
- Significant reduction in console set-up and tear-down time enhances overall workflow.
- UNITY VCS decreases cataract surgery turnover time by 6%, which is vital for high-volume practices.
